Recall the main structural components of plant cell walls, which provide rigidity and support to plant cells.
Identify the polysaccharides listed in the options: Chitin, Peptidoglycan, Glycogen, and Cellulose, and consider their biological roles and where they are commonly found.
Understand that Chitin is primarily found in fungal cell walls and exoskeletons of arthropods, Peptidoglycan is a major component of bacterial cell walls, and Glycogen serves as an energy storage polysaccharide in animals.
Recognize that Cellulose is a polysaccharide composed of β-glucose units linked by β-1,4-glycosidic bonds, forming long chains that provide structural support in plant cell walls.
Conclude that the main polysaccharide in plant cell walls is Cellulose, which is responsible for the strength and rigidity of the plant tissue.
